This Pinot Noir offers bright, aromatic fruit aromas of blueberry and plum melding alongside violet, cinnamon and nutmeg, with aniseed influence. Its palate is jam-packed with red fruit and savoury character all overlaid with a subtle texture and fine grain tannin. This ensures a well integrated, focused and poised wine with lovely length.
The journey for this wine begins in the Waihopai Vineyard in the Waihopai Valley in Marlborough. The vineyard has 20 year old vines, free draining river gravels with mixed silt loam over a clay base. The vineyard is nurtured with meticulous hands-on viticulture to ensure fruit each vintage produces highly concentrated flavour.
A selection of wines which speak of the special place they come from, crafted from single vineyards with unique terroir and climate. Our winemakers ensure the purity of the wine becomes a showcase of the land.
Waihopai Valley, Marlborough - Waihopai Vineyard
Fruit is selectively hand harvested and warmed immediately before fermentation.
The wine is rested in 300L Hogshead barrels with a portion of up to 30% new oak.

"2015 Vintage: Beautifully lifted aromas of dark cherry, plum, game, clove and dried herb on the nose. The impact on the palate is elegant and soothing, yet with great power and persistency. Very fine, poised and promising to evolve magnificently. At its best: 2018 to 2025."
Sam Kim - Wine Orbit
"2014 Vintage: One of Giesen's top single-vineyard wines, this is elegant and silky. Aromas of red berries, flowers, coffee grounds and cinnamon sticks are wrapped in a savory, dried leaf core. Light to medium in body, everything is in balance, from the delicate acidity and satiny tannins to the juicy, tart red fruit and floral flavors. Drink now–2026. March 2018"
Wine Enthusiast Magazine
